Kinetic Studies on the Formation and Decomposition of Bis(peroxo)oxochromium(VI) in Aqueous Solution

Abstract

The reaction of chromic acid with hydrogen peroxide is studied kinetically and the stability of the product throughout the formation of adducts with donor molecules is investigated.
